// EnvVars converts an OCI process environment variables slice
// into a virtcontainers EnvVar slice.
func EnvVars(envs []string) ([]types.EnvVar, error) {
var envVars []types.EnvVar
envDelimiter := "="
expectedEnvLen := 2
for _, env := range envs {
envSlice := strings.SplitN(env, envDelimiter, expectedEnvLen)
if len(envSlice) < expectedEnvLen {
return []types.EnvVar{}, fmt.Errorf("Wrong string format: %s, expecting only %v parameters separated with %q",
env, expectedEnvLen, envDelimiter)
}
if envSlice[0] == "" {
return []types.EnvVar{}, fmt.Errorf("Environment variable cannot be empty")
}
envSlice[1] = strings.Trim(envSlice[1], "' ")
envVar := types.EnvVar{
Var: envSlice[0],
Value: envSlice[1],
}
envVars = append(envVars, envVar)
}
return envVars, nil
}
